Getting There
-
Car
If you are driving to Gaushala Ground from any part of the Central Development Region, start by navigating towards Kathmandu city. Use the Ring Road as a reference. Once you reach the area of Pashupatinath, look for the P84W+JFQ location on Ring Road. Gaushala Ground is easily accessible from the Ring Road. Parking may be available nearby, but it's advisable to check local signs for parking regulations.
-
Public Transportation (Bus)
To reach Gaushala Ground via public transport, you can board a local bus from any major bus station in Kathmandu heading towards Pashupatinath. Look for buses that have 'Pashupatinath' or 'Gaushala' on their signboards. Once you arrive at the Pashupatinath bus stop, you will need to walk approximately 10-15 minutes to reach Gaushala Ground, following the Ring Road. Make sure to ask locals for directions if you're unsure.
-
Taxi or Ride-sharing
For a more comfortable journey, you can hire a taxi or use a ride-sharing app to get to Gaushala Ground. Simply enter 'Gaushala Ground, P84W+JFQ, Ring Rd, Kathmandu 44600' as your destination. This option will take you directly to the location without the need to navigate public transport. The cost may vary depending on your starting point, so it's best to confirm the fare before beginning your journey.
